본문 바로가기 메뉴 바로가기

개발자 Emma

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

개발자 Emma

검색하기 폼
  • 분류 전체보기 (57)
    • 개발 (50)
  • 방명록

2024/11/18 (1)
Test-Driven Development (TDD) 란 ?

**TDD(테스트 중심 개발)**는 실제 코드를 작성하기 전에 테스트를 작성하는 소프트웨어 개발 방법론입니다. 코드가 테스트에 정의된 요구 사항을 충족하는지 확인하여 보다 체계적이고 오류 없는 개발 프로세스를 조성합니다. TDD의 주요 단계테스트 작성:기능이나 특징을 정의하는 단위 테스트를 만듭니다.기능이 아직 구현되지 않았으므로 처음에는 테스트가 실패해야 합니다.최소 코드 작성:테스트를 통과하는 데 충분한 코드만 구현하십시오. 최적화 없이 기능에만 집중하세요.리팩터링:모든 테스트가 통과하는지 확인하면서 코드를 정리하세요. 이 단계는 코드 품질과 유지 관리성을 향상시킵니다.반복:추가 테스트 및 코드 구현을 계속 반복합니다. TDD의 이점향상된 코드 품질:개발자가 명확하고 테스트 가능하며 모듈식 코드를 작..

개발 2024. 11. 18. 14:44
이전 1 다음
이전 다음
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
  • ChatGPT
  • JavaScript
  • 캐시란
  • commit convetion
  • 개발자
  • Java
  • 캐시스탬피드
  • css
  • spring.io.start
  • 더현대 크리스마스 현장대기
  • synchronized 단점
  • spring
  • API
  • 항해후기
  • tdd개발
  • mock사용법
  • mock해야하는대상과아닌것
  • Springboot jpa
  • 풀스택
  • google commit convention
  • 프로그래밍
  • Grammarly
  • 백엔드개발
  • html
  • 티스토리챌린지
  • postgresql brew
  • 웹개발
  • 오블완
  • java test 개발
  • postgresql 다운로드
more
«   2024/11   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
글 보관함

Blog is powered by Tistory / Designed by Tistory

티스토리툴바